The XLR adapter, a staple in expert audio, is mainly known for its sturdiness and ability to carry well balanced sound signals, which dramatically lowers disturbance and noise. With the introduction of wireless modern technology, the timeless XLR's capability can now be attained without the physical secure. Wireless XLRs utilize radio frequencies to transfer audio signals from a resource, like a microphone or tool, to a receiver that links straight to speakers or a mixing console. Among the most compelling benefits of using wireless XLR systems is the elimination of wire mess, which can not only impede the visual of a performance location but additionally create prospective hazards for entertainers and staff alike. By lowering these trip threats, the overall security and efficiency of an event are substantially boosted.

The modern technology behind wireless XLR systems has progressed substantially recently. Modern systems frequently make use of digital transmission methods, which use improved quality, decreased latency, and extended array compared to older analog systems. High-quality electronic wireless systems can operate over better distances and supply more trustworthy transmission, making them suitable also for larger locations or exterior events. Customers can feel confident that the audio quality stays immaculate, with very little loss of integrity, allowing real significance of the performance to radiate through. Furthermore, with growths in frequency-hopping spread spectrum (FHSS) innovation, modern-day wireless systems can quickly change in between regularities to avoid interference from other wireless tools, making certain a stable link no matter the environment.

The configuration process for wireless XLR systems has actually additionally come to be a lot more structured, thanks to intuitive layouts that satisfy both novices and seasoned specialists. Numerous systems now feature automated frequency scanning, which permits customers to swiftly recognize the finest offered network for transmission, decreasing configuration time and technical challenges before efficiencies. Better boosting simplicity of use, some systems are additionally geared up with smartphone applications that allow surveillance and control of other criteria and audio degrees remotely. This attribute is particularly valuable for sound designers who require to make adjustments while taking care of multiple audio sources at the same time.

While the benefits of wireless XLR systems are considerable, there are also elements to consider when making the shift from conventional wired configurations. Given that wireless transmitters run using batteries, keeping sufficient power degrees throughout an event comes to be important.

Users should be enlightened concerning the different kinds of wireless transmission, which may impact their choices in specific environments. Different wireless systems operate on various frequency bands-- usually UHF, VHF, or electronic.

Customers of wireless systems must be conscious of laws set forth by regulating bodies pertaining to regularity use, as particular bands may require licensing or might be more vulnerable to congestion from other tools. Recognizing the lawful facets of wireless audio transmission guarantees that users remain certified and won't encounter disturbances during their efficiencies due to unauthorized regularity usage.
